Tender Title: Supply of Spare Parts
Tender Reference Number: GEM/2025/B/6153228
Issuing Authority: Department of Military Affairs, Ministry of Defence
The scope of work involves the procurement of various spare parts essential for military vehicles and equipment. This includes components such as Armature assembly (24V), Brush plate, Clutch plate, Derivation tank, Engine mounting pad front, Field coil (24V), and Fuel pump. These parts are critical for the maintenance and operational readiness of our military fleet and must meet stringent performance standards.
